请问cot=ConnectionFactory.getConnection();的ConnectionFactory.和Purchase()为什么报错啊


再分享一下我老师大神的人工智能教程吧零基础!通俗易懂!风趣幽默!还带黄段子!希望你也加入到我们人工智能的队伍中来!


推荐于 · TA获得超过143个赞

防火墙关叻再试一下。

5.是不是你数据库设置了最大连接然后其他项目的连接池又把连接占用完了呢。

你对这个回答的评价是

下载百度知道APP,搶鲜体验

使用百度知道APP立即抢鲜体验。你的手机镜头里或许有别人想知道的答案

先说一下怎么配置不同的redis源吧.

##连接的最大等待阻塞的时间 ##最大和最小空闲连接

如果是单数据源配置就没这么麻烦了但是这里,一个数据库作为 cache ,一个作为 session所以自然是多數据源配置。

* 后面我会详细讲解的,各位同学也可先自己看看源码 //根据配置和客户端配置创建连接 * 读取配置文件里的redis配置

。。。。。。。。。。。。。。。。。。。。。

原理: 这里先贴一段源码,但是各位同学也必须点进去看一看才能明白:

上图源码是 LettuceConnection 的其中4个个构造函数,说起来是4个但是各位仔细看就他妈是一个构造函数啊。

这几个构造函数的第一个参数都昰RedisConfiguration第二个参数是LettuceClientConfiguration,看到这两个类的名字,顿时应该猜出78分了吧。就是 普通配置和客户端配置

看到这里明白了吧,非常简单只是我在看源码的时候,感觉非常的绕Spring的源码就是这样,它的思想就是掩盖实现约定大于配置,让你更关注逻辑代码而不是这些原理。看这些实现源码往往是训练你的设计模式和对底层原理的认识让你知道为什么这样写,而不是为了设计模式而写设计模式

路漫漫,求索不斷呀。。。。。。。。。。

注:中的org.h2.jdbcx.JdbcConnectionPool.getConnection方法示例整理自Github/MSDocs等源碼忣文檔管理平台相關代碼片段篩選自各路編程大神貢獻的開源項目,源碼版權歸原作者所有傳播和使用請參考對應項目的License;未經允許,請勿轉載

我要回帖

更多关于 get to 的文章

 

随机推荐